The US Department of State has announced changes to the visa application procedure.
Certain visa applicants will no longer be required to attend an in-person interview as part of the process.
The Bureau of Consular Affairs has amended the list of candidates who may be eligible for a waiver of the nonimmigrant visa interview.
Consular officials may now waive the in-person interview for the groups indicated in section 222(h) of the Immigration and Nationality Act.
This new development overrides the version from December 21st, 2023. It is intended to expedite and simplify the visa application process for many candidates.

It’s important to note that even if an applicant meets these criteria, consular officers maintain the discretion to request an in-person interview based on specific circumstances or local conditions.
The updated process is expected to reduce visa processing times for eligible applicants. Without the need to schedule and attend an in-person interview, applicants can expect a smoother and faster experience. This is especially beneficial for those seeking to renew visas that have expired within the last 12 months, as they can now do so without the interview requirement.
What to know
Despite the new procedures, applicants should be aware that consular officers still have the authority to request an interview on a case-by-case basis. It is important for applicants to check the specific requirements of the U.S. embassy or consulate where they are applying, as conditions may vary depending on location.
The U.S. Department of State’s latest update for the visa application process interprets that applicants who qualify will experience a faster and more efficient process, reducing wait times for interview slots providing relief for many applicants.
